			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Lately I&#8217;ve been thinking a lot about rebranding myself.  If I would have understood who I was to begin with my &#8220;brand&#8221; would be much clearer, but now I&#8217;m in a discovery phase.  I think too many of us forget about who we want to be or become, and not enough of the how we want to represent ourselves.</p>
<p>That sort of mentality makes me immediately think of the things people have done to make it in Hollywood.  Selling themselves short and doing things they wouldn&#8217;t be proud of.  Something that could taint their brand if at any time their competitors needed a scandalous edge to put them down in order to lift themselves up.</p>
<p><span id="more-164"></span></p>
<h3>What I Have to Show</h3>
<p>I&#8217;ve been involved in the internet now since 1996 you could say and I have very little to show because I&#8217;ve spent so much time working on other people&#8217;s brands and taking what I could get to make some extra cash to get something cool or to pay my bills.  I&#8217;m kicking myself understanding how much time has been lost.  Sure I can put together a portfolio of stuff I&#8217;ve done, but many of the people I&#8217;ve worked with haven&#8217;t done much with the sites that I&#8217;ve designed and set up for them.</p>
<h3>What I Do</h3>
<p>&#8220;What do I do?&#8221;, seems to be the question that I&#8217;ve been asking myself a lot lately.  At the same time asking &#8220;What don&#8217;t I do?&#8221;  I&#8217;ve spent a lot of time in the past not spelling out to clients what I do and more generally speaking what most web designers do.</p>
<p>I&#8217;ve recently been listening a lot to podcasts and mostly others who were once in my shoes and who have seemed to walk much better in my shoes.  I&#8217;m starting to discover my weaknesses a bit more and discovering that most my weaknesses draw from trying to be too clear to clients and not asking enough of clients.  I find myself working with someone just because they are referred to me and I want to help them.  But I find that they don&#8217;t need someone like me for what they are trying to do.</p>
<h3>Don&#8217;t Overcomplicate</h3>
<p>In my journey of discovering who I want to be I&#8217;ve discovered I like to over-think things.  Most likely that comes out of trying to foresee future problems that may arise when clients need a bit more complicated solution beyond their immediate needs.  I&#8217;m beginning to understand how necessary it is to build things out in phases.</p>
<h3>Mutual Goal Achievement</h3>
<p>I have to look at what I do as more of a solution to reach a goal.  Clients have goals.  Everyone in life should have goals.  Most big goals require many small goals that add up to the big goal.  If I can take that perspective, I no longer work for a client and I no longer jump when they say jump, I consult and give direction understanding what their goals are.  I work with a client making sure that my goals some how are being reached by working with those clients so we both are moving forward with our objectives.</p>
<h3>Setting Goals and Only Moving Forward</h3>
<p>I&#8217;m hoping to truly define what my goals are in the next little bit so I can more effectively brand myself and what I do.  I am committed now to only work on things and work with clients that allow me to reach my goals in helping them reach theirs.</p>
